Welcome, new folks: this entry documents changed defaults, which we record carefully because fleets pick them up on next check-in. The stable channel now staggers rollouts over 72 hours instead of pushing immediately, devices verify firmware signatures before staging (previously after), and the rollback threshold tightened from 5% failure to 2%. Beta devices are unaffected. These defaults only apply where a fleet has no explicit override. The full set of new default configuration values follows.

config for kagup-hahig:
druwyn:
  pin: 2801
  metrics_host: metrics.druwyn.zemvarlabs.internal
  tenant: sorius
  seal: seal_798a43d7

Q3 Planning Note — Supplier Renewal

Quick heads-up for all branch managers: our packaging contract with Torvale Supply comes up for renewal in October. Marit's team has been benchmarking alternatives, and Torvale knows it — they've already hinted at better volume pricing. Please hold off on committing to any side orders until the renewal terms land. We expect a decision before the Halden branch review. The direction we're leaning is below.

confidential, kagup-bafog: Fraaxax Group is in early talks to buy Soroxox Group for about $343.8 million. The Olidor launch date is June 14, and nothing goes to the press before then. Legal wants the Aldmirek Logistics term sheet signed before July 23.

Subject: Key rotation — formula sandbox service

Hi Marisol,

Heads up before Thursday's release: we rotated the credentials for the Greenmantle sandbox, the service that isolates user-supplied formulas in Tallyforge. The old key dies at cutover, so make sure the release pipeline picks up the new one. Staging is already updated and passing. Here's the fresh key for the production config.

gateway credential: kto23_LX9A4ys6i4nzHtpOLNLodKK

# Onboarding: RestockRoute Planner

Welcome to the Fizzwick contract team. RestockRoute ingests vending-machine telemetry each morning, forecasts sell-through per slot, and emits optimized restock routes for the field drivers. Your first task is running the planner against the sandbox fleet. The planner calls our internal telemetry service on startup, and it authenticates using the key below.

service key, fawip-bajef: kto11_Qt5wZK9vdNC